2012 ELGIN BROOM BADGER RECALL - #14V666000

RECALL FOR ENGINE AND ENGINE COOLING : ENGINE : DIESEL

Elgin Sweeper Company Inc. (Elgin) is recalling certain model year 2012-2014 Broom Badger sweeper trucks manufactured March 1, 2013, to October 1, 2014. The affected vehicles are equipped with a modification hydraulic oil cooler fan wiring harness. The oil cooler fan may fail and cause overheating.

Vehicle 2012 ELGIN BROOM BADGER
Manufacturer Elgin Sweeper Company Inc.
Manufactured between 3/1/2013 - 10/1/2014
Recalled on 10/22/2014
Influenced by Elgin Sweeper Company Inc.
Owners Notified on 12/1/2014
# Affected 92
Recalled for ENGINE AND ENGINE COOLING:ENGINE:DIESEL
Description Elgin Sweeper Company Inc. (Elgin) is recalling certain model year 2012-2014 Broom Badger sweeper trucks manufactured March 1, 2013, to October 1, 2014. The affected vehicles are equipped with a modification hydraulic oil cooler fan wiring harness. The oil cooler fan may fail and cause overheating.
Consequences If the oil cooler fan fails and the hydraulic system overheats, a vehicle fire could result.
Corrective action Elgin will notify owners, and dealers will install a modified wiring harness that separates ground wires form the fan and sending unit, free of charge. The recall began December 1, 2014. Owners may contact Elgin customer service at 1-847-741-5370. Elgin's number for this recall is SB-0148.
